Roof enlargement services involve extending the existing roof structure of a property to create additional space or improve functionality. This process typically includes adding new sections or extending current rooflines to match the existing design, ensuring a seamless appearance. Local contractors who specialize in roof enlargement can assess the property's current structure, determine the best approach for expansion, and execute the work with attention to detail. This service is often chosen by homeowners seeking to increase living space, add new rooms, or enhance the overall utility of their property without the need for a full rebuild.
One common reason for considering roof enlargement is to address limited space within a home. For example, a family might need an extra bedroom, a home office, or a larger attic for storage. In some cases, properties with underutilized or awkwardly shaped roofs can be expanded to better serve the needs of the household. Roof enlargement can also help improve the overall appearance of a property by creating a more balanced or proportionate roofline, especially on older or smaller homes that may feel cramped or out of scale.
This service is typically used on resid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and cottages. It is especially popular in neighborhoods where property sizes are fixed, and homeowners want to maximize their existing footprint. Properties with steep or complex roof designs may require more detailed planning, but a skilled local contractor can handle these challenges. The overview below groups typical Roof Enlargement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Linn,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Roof Extensions - Typical costs for minor roof enlargement projects, such as adding a small dormer or extending a section, generally range from $2,500 to $6,000.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um. Local contractors can often provide estimates within this band based on project size and complexity.
Moderate Expansion Projects - Mid-sized roof enlargements, including larger dormers or partial extensions, typically cost between $6,000 and $15,000. These projects are common for homeowners seeking noticeable additional space, with costs varying depending on materials and design details. Larger, more complex jobs can push beyond this range but are less frequent.
Full Roof Rebuilds or Major Extensions - Extensive roof enlargement projects, such as full rebuilds or significant structural additions, can range from $15,000 to $50,000 or more. Such projects are less common and tend to involve complex planning and materials, leading to higher costs. Local service providers can assess specific needs to provide accurate estimates for these larger jobs.
Additional Costs and Variations - Costs can vary significantly based on factors like roof size, materials, and local labor rates. Many projects fall into the middle to upper-middle ranges, while highly customized or complex enlargements may reach higher prices. Consulting local contractors can help clarify the expected investment for specific roof enlargement need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of enlargement? Roof enlargement involves expanding the existing roof structure to increase attic space, improve drainage, or enhance the overall appearance of a building.
Why consider roof enlargement services? Homeowners may opt for roof enlargement to add usable space, improve ventilation, or update the roof's design to better suit their needs.
What types of roof enlargement are available? Local contractors typically offer options such as dormer additions, extension of roof lines, or raising the roof pitch to create more interior space.
How do local service providers handle roof enlargement projects? Experienced contractors evaluate the existing structure, plan the expansion, and execute the work to ensure proper integration with the current roof and building.
What should be considered before starting a roof enlargement? It’s important to assess the building’s structural capacity, obtain necessary permits, and discuss design options with local professionals to ensure a successful project.
